Home
last modified time | relevance | path

Searched refs:PINGPONG_0 (Results 1 - 25 of 39) sorted by relevance

12

/kernel/linux/linux-5.10/drivers/gpu/drm/msm/disp/dpu1/
H A Ddpu_encoder_phys_cmd.c92 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_pp_tx_done_irq()
203 phys_enc->hw_pp->idx - PINGPONG_0, in _dpu_encoder_phys_cmd_handle_ppdone_timeout()
212 phys_enc->hw_pp->idx - PINGPONG_0, in _dpu_encoder_phys_cmd_handle_ppdone_timeout()
279 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_control_vblank_irq()
292 phys_enc->hw_pp->idx - PINGPONG_0, ret, in dpu_encoder_phys_cmd_control_vblank_irq()
303 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_irq_control()
342 DPU_DEBUG_CMDENC(cmd_enc, "pp %d\n", phys_enc->hw_pp->idx - PINGPONG_0); in dpu_encoder_phys_cmd_tearcheck_config()
388 phys_enc->hw_pp->idx - PINGPONG_0, vsync_hz, in dpu_encoder_phys_cmd_tearcheck_config()
392 phys_enc->hw_pp->idx - PINGPONG_0, tc_enable, tc_cfg.start_pos, in dpu_encoder_phys_cmd_tearcheck_config()
396 phys_enc->hw_pp->idx - PINGPONG_0, tc_cf in dpu_encoder_phys_cmd_tearcheck_config()
[all...]
H A Ddpu_rm.h27 struct dpu_hw_blk *pingpong_blks[PINGPONG_MAX - PINGPONG_0];
H A Ddpu_hw_interrupts.c265 { DPU_IRQ_TYPE_PING_PONG_COMP, PINGPONG_0,
274 { DPU_IRQ_TYPE_PING_PONG_RD_PTR, PINGPONG_0,
283 { DPU_IRQ_TYPE_PING_PONG_WR_PTR, PINGPONG_0,
292 { DPU_IRQ_TYPE_PING_PONG_AUTO_REF, PINGPONG_0,
342 { DPU_IRQ_TYPE_PING_PONG_TEAR_CHECK, PINGPONG_0,
357 { DPU_IRQ_TYPE_PING_PONG_TE_CHECK, PINGPONG_0,
H A Ddpu_hw_catalog.c402 &sdm845_lm_sblk, PINGPONG_0, LM_1, 0),
427 &sc7180_lm_sblk, PINGPONG_0, LM_1, DSPP_0),
436 &sdm845_lm_sblk, PINGPONG_0, LM_1, 0),
500 PP_BLK_TE("pingpong_0", PINGPONG_0, 0x70000),
507 PP_BLK_TE("pingpong_0", PINGPONG_0, 0x70000),
512 PP_BLK_TE("pingpong_0", PINGPONG_0, 0x70000),
H A Ddpu_rm.c134 if (pp->id < PINGPONG_0 || pp->id >= PINGPONG_MAX) { in dpu_rm_init()
145 rm->pingpong_blks[pp->id - PINGPONG_0] = &hw->base; in dpu_rm_init()
273 idx = lm_cfg->pingpong - PINGPONG_0; in _dpu_rm_check_lm_and_get_connected_blks()
374 pp_idx[i] + PINGPONG_0); in _dpu_rm_reserve_lms()
H A Ddpu_kms.h165 uint32_t pingpong_to_enc_id[PINGPONG_MAX - PINGPONG_0];
H A Ddpu_encoder.c39 (p) ? ((p)->hw_pp ? (p)->hw_pp->idx - PINGPONG_0 : -1) : -1, \
45 (p) ? ((p)->hw_pp ? (p)->hw_pp->idx - PINGPONG_0 : -1) : -1, \
249 phys_enc->hw_pp->idx - PINGPONG_0, intr_idx); in dpu_encoder_helper_report_irq_timeout()
293 irq->irq_idx, ph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_helper_wait_for_irq()
311 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_helper_wait_for_irq()
323 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_helper_wait_for_irq()
330 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_helper_wait_for_irq()
/kernel/linux/linux-6.6/drivers/gpu/drm/msm/disp/dpu1/
H A Ddpu_encoder_phys_cmd.c98 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_pp_tx_done_irq()
189 phys_enc->hw_pp->idx - PINGPONG_0, in _dpu_encoder_phys_cmd_handle_ppdone_timeout()
198 phys_enc->hw_pp->idx - PINGPONG_0, in _dpu_encoder_phys_cmd_handle_ppdone_timeout()
266 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_control_vblank_irq()
282 phys_enc->hw_pp->idx - PINGPONG_0, ret, in dpu_encoder_phys_cmd_control_vblank_irq()
293 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_irq_control()
351 DPU_DEBUG_CMDENC(cmd_enc, "pp %d\n", phys_enc->hw_pp->idx - PINGPONG_0); in dpu_encoder_phys_cmd_tearcheck_config()
421 phys_enc->hw_pp->idx - PINGPONG_0); in _dpu_encoder_phys_cmd_pingpong_config()
469 DPU_DEBUG_CMDENC(cmd_enc, "pp %d\n", phys_enc->hw_pp->idx - PINGPONG_0); in dpu_encoder_phys_cmd_enable()
551 phys_enc->hw_pp->idx - PINGPONG_0, in dpu_encoder_phys_cmd_disable()
[all...]
H A Ddpu_hw_pingpong.c161 trace_dpu_pp_connect_ext_te(pp->idx - PINGPONG_0, cfg); in dpu_hw_pp_connect_external_te()
242 encoder_id, pp->idx - PINGPONG_0); in dpu_hw_pp_disable_autorefresh()
255 encoder_id, pp->idx - PINGPONG_0); in dpu_hw_pp_disable_autorefresh()
H A Ddpu_hw_dsc.c169 mux_cfg = (pp - PINGPONG_0) & 0x7; in dpu_hw_dsc_bind_pingpong_blk()
173 hw_dsc->idx - DSC_0, pp - PINGPONG_0); in dpu_hw_dsc_bind_pingpong_blk()
H A Ddpu_rm.h27 struct dpu_hw_blk *pingpong_blks[PINGPONG_MAX - PINGPONG_0];
H A Ddpu_kms.h135 uint32_t pingpong_to_enc_id[PINGPONG_MAX - PINGPONG_0];
H A Ddpu_rm.c158 rm->pingpong_blks[pp->id - PINGPONG_0] = &hw->base; in dpu_rm_init()
305 idx = lm_cfg->pingpong - PINGPONG_0; in _dpu_rm_check_lm_and_get_connected_blks()
405 pp_idx[i] + PINGPONG_0); in _dpu_rm_reserve_lms()
/kernel/linux/linux-6.6/drivers/gpu/drm/msm/disp/dpu1/catalog/
H A Ddpu_6_3_sm6115.h64 .pingpong = PINGPONG_0,
80 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_6_5_qcm2290.h63 .pingpong = PINGPONG_0,
79 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_6_9_sm6375.h66 .pingpong = PINGPONG_0,
82 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_6_2_sc7180.h94 .pingpong = PINGPONG_0,
117 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_6_4_sm6350.h101 .pingpong = PINGPONG_0,
125 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_5_4_sm6125.h101 .pingpong = PINGPONG_0,
126 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_7_2_sc7280.h98 .pingpong = PINGPONG_0,
128 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_3_0_msm8998.h143 .pingpong = PINGPONG_0,
184 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_7_0_sm8350.h149 .pingpong = PINGPONG_0,
216 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_6_0_sm8250.h149 .pingpong = PINGPONG_0,
216 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_5_1_sc8180x.h149 .pingpong = PINGPONG_0,
216 .name = "pingpong_0", .id = PINGPONG_0,
H A Ddpu_8_0_sc8280xp.h149 .pingpong = PINGPONG_0,
218 .name = "pingpong_0", .id = PINGPONG_0,

Completed in 16 milliseconds

12